Current State of Biomass and Bioenergy in India: 2026 Insights



India's bioenergy sector is currently growing faster than the country's overall energy demand, positioning it as a key pillar for emissions reduction. The CBG Blending Obligation (CBO), which starts at 1% in FY 2025/26 and rises to 5% by 2028/29, ensures a stable offtake mechanism for producers.

The Digital and Technical Evolution of India's Biofuel Supply Chain



Automation in pellet manufacturing plants now allows for real-time monitoring of moisture levels and calorific output, ensuring a standardized product for industrial buyers. The integration of IoT and AI in biorefineries has optimized the fermentation process, leading to higher ethanol yields from diverse feedstocks.
